Web13 apr. 2024 · Inertia friction welding (IFW) has been proven to be a suitable welding method for titanium alloy and has widely been used in aerospace and other high-tech fields due to its advantages, such as high quality, high efficiency, environmental friendliness, low heat input, small deformation, and narrow welding seam [4,9]. Web15 mrt. 2024 · Inertia friction welding (IFW) is a solid-state welding process that uses inertia forces to join two metals without additional materials like flux or filler metal. Doing so produces strong welds with minimal distortion while also being more cost-effective than other methods like gas tungsten arc welding (GTAW). http://www.ifweld.com/

Web30 nov. 2024 · Inertial friction welding (IFW), as a solid state welding procedure, has the advantages of fewer process parameters, low heat input, small deformation and narrow welding seam [ 16, 17 ]. In addition, high quality, high efficient, environmental friendliness, and precise power input control are well reflected in IFW.
